Biography

Charla’s leadership in the legal community reflects her commitment to excellence. She has served as President of the Collaborative Divorce Professionals of San Antonio and Chair of the Family Law Section of the San Antonio Bar Association. Her legal expertise and dedication have earned her recognition in The Best Lawyers in America and San Antonio Scene’s “Best Lawyers in San Antonio.”

Charla recognizes that divorce is a challenging transition, but with the right guidance, it can be a turning point toward a better future. She is committed to supporting clients through this process with professionalism and stability, helping them make informed decisions that align with their long-term goals.
